I had emailed yesterday since I didn't want to miss out the details. Got a reply today morning.

Quote:

Please submit application in person as per enclosed checklist on any working day between Monday to Friday except Govt. holiday (09.45hrs to 13.00hrs) (Walk in)

Applicant aged 5 yrs and above should physically present during submission of application alongwith parents.

For applicant below 5 yrs, any one of the parent should present during submission of application at this office with authorization from other(wife/husband) and all pages should attested by both parents including application.
They also added a OCI checklist. I have attached it. There is a demand draft requirement too.

Nope. OCI needs only be reissued once the child crosses 20 years old. There was a need to reissue once you cross 50 but that has been rescinded unless you change your name/residence etc. You just need to upload your latest photo and passport.

It did not take much time in Mumbai FRRO (less than 30 minutes), We had scheduled an appointment and it was smooth.

Yes, we had to visit Mumbai personally to collect OCI card.

The original passport and OCI was with us until we received the new OCI. They will collect the old OCI when they issue new OCI.

Application and required documents were uploaded online and for payment, we prepared the DD in Pune before visiting Mumbai.
